Exactly 300 of Louisiana's 13,630 human services professionals work in Monroe. Between 2006 and 2010, the number of human services professionals in Monroe has grown by 30%. As the number of human services professionals in Monroe has increased, overall employment in Monroe has decreased.

As the number of human services professionals in Monroe has grown, salaries for human services professionals have decreased. In 2010 an average salary of $34,225 per year was earned by human services professionals in Monroe. The average salary for human services professionals in Monroe was $36,697 per year, four years earlier in 2006. This decline is slower than the salary trend for all careers in Monroe.

Human services professionals make a median salary of $32,410 per year in Monroe. The difference in pay between the human services professionals in the lowest pay bracket and those in the highest pay bracket is approximately 110%. Those in the lowest 10% of the pay bracket earn less than $22,885 per year, while those in the highest 10% of the pay bracket earn more than $48,145 per year.
